Governor Bob Holden has signed into law a bill that makes it more expensive for people who ignore calls to jury duty. The fine for failing to show up is doubled – to $500, and a judge can order the no-show to do community service, too. The same bill bars employers from requiring workers to take vacation time if they have to serve on a jury.
